Industrial AGVs: Optimizing Performance with Reliable Motor Drive Wheels


Introduction to Industrial AGVs


Automated Guided Vehicles (AGVs) have revolutionized material handling in various industries, including manufacturing, warehousing, and logistics. These autonomous vehicles are designed to transport goods efficiently and safely within a facility. The performance of an AGV largely depends on its motor drive wheels, which play a critical role in mobility, stability, and overall efficiency.

The Importance of Motor Drive Wheels in AGVs


Motor drive wheels are essential components that provide propulsion and control to AGVs. These wheels must be reliable, efficient, and capable of handling various loads and terrains. Here are some key aspects highlighting their importance:

1. Enhanced Maneuverability


AGVs equipped with high-quality motor drive wheels exhibit improved maneuverability, allowing them to navigate tight spaces and complex layouts with ease. This capability is crucial in maximizing operational efficiency and reducing delivery times within a facility.

2. Stability and Load Management


Reliable motor drive wheels contribute significantly to the stability of AGVs, particularly when transporting heavy loads. Properly designed wheels ensure that the AGV maintains its balance, minimizing the risk of tipping or accidents.

3. Energy Efficiency


Energy-efficient motor drive wheels reduce the overall power consumption of AGVs. This not only lowers operational costs but also extends battery life, allowing for longer operational periods without frequent recharging.

4. Durability and Maintenance


The durability of motor drive wheels directly impacts the maintenance frequency and costs associated with AGVs. High-quality materials and designs can withstand the rigors of industrial environments, reducing the need for repairs or replacements.

Types of Motor Drive Wheels for AGVs


Understanding the different types of motor drive wheels available is essential for optimizing AGV performance. Here, we explore various wheel types and their applications:

1. Polyurethane Wheels


Polyurethane wheels are popular due to their excellent grip and resistance to wear. They are ideal for indoor applications where smooth flooring is present. These wheels provide a quiet and smooth ride, making them suitable for environments that require minimal noise.

2. Rubber Wheels


Rubber wheels offer superior shock absorption and traction, making them suitable for both indoor and outdoor use. They perform well on uneven surfaces, providing better stability and control for AGVs navigating diverse terrains.

3. Steel Wheels


Steel wheels are often used in heavy-duty applications where high load-bearing capabilities are required. These wheels are designed to withstand extreme conditions and provide long-lasting performance, making them ideal for manufacturing and warehousing settings.

4. Caster Wheels


Caster wheels provide flexibility and agility, allowing AGVs to pivot easily. These wheels are essential for applications that require quick directional changes and maneuverability in tight spaces.

Factors to Consider When Choosing Motor Drive Wheels


Selecting the right motor drive wheels for AGVs is crucial for optimizing their performance. Here are some factors to consider:

1. Load Capacity


The load capacity of the wheels must match the maximum weight the AGV is expected to transport. Overloading wheels can lead to premature wear and potential failures.

2. Surface Conditions


Different wheel materials are suited for various surface conditions. Consider whether the AGV will operate on smooth concrete floors or rough outdoor terrains when selecting wheels.

3. Speed Requirements


The required speed of the AGV can influence the choice of wheel type. Faster AGVs may benefit from wheels that optimize speed without compromising stability.

4. Environmental Factors


Assessing environmental conditions, such as temperature extremes, moisture levels, and exposure to chemicals, is crucial in selecting durable and reliable motor drive wheels.

How to Optimize AGV Performance with Reliable Motor Drive Wheels


Optimizing AGV performance involves more than just selecting the right motor drive wheels. Here are some best practices:

1. Regular Maintenance


Routine maintenance is essential for ensuring that motor drive wheels function optimally. Regular inspections for wear, damage, and proper alignment can prevent costly breakdowns.

2. Calibration and Adjustments


Proper calibration of the motor and wheels is vital for maintaining speed and control. Regular adjustments based on the load and operating conditions can enhance performance.

3. Training Operators


Educating operators on the capabilities and limitations of AGVs can improve their efficiency. Training should cover proper loading techniques, navigation skills, and safety measures.

4. Implementing Advanced Technology


Integrating advanced technologies, such as sensors and control systems, can enhance the performance of AGVs. These technologies enable real-time monitoring and adjustments, leading to improved operational efficiency.

Case Studies: Successful Implementation of Motor Drive Wheels in AGVs


Examining real-world applications can provide valuable insights into the benefits of reliable motor drive wheels in AGVs. Here are a few case studies:

1. Automotive Manufacturing


In an automotive manufacturing facility, the implementation of polyurethane motor drive wheels in AGVs resulted in a 25% increase in material handling efficiency. The wheels provided excellent traction on smooth factory floors, reducing the number of accidents and improving safety.

2. Warehouse Operations


A major logistics company optimized its AGV fleet by upgrading to rubber wheels. This change allowed the AGVs to navigate both indoor and outdoor surfaces while maintaining stability and speed, ultimately enhancing overall productivity.

3. Food Processing


In a food processing plant, stainless steel motor drive wheels were introduced to AGVs to meet hygiene standards. The wheels’ durability and resistance to corrosion contributed to a significant reduction in maintenance costs over time.

Future Trends in Motor Drive Wheel Technology for AGVs


As technology continues to evolve, several trends are emerging in motor drive wheel technology for AGVs:

1. Smart Wheels


The development of smart wheels equipped with sensors will allow for real-time monitoring of performance and wear. This innovation will enable predictive maintenance and reduce downtime.

2. Lightweight Materials


Research into lightweight materials will lead to the production of more efficient wheels that reduce energy consumption while maintaining strength and durability.

3. Customization Options


The demand for customized motor drive wheels tailored to specific applications is rising. Manufacturers are increasingly offering customizable solutions to meet unique operational needs.

FAQs about Motor Drive Wheels in AGVs


1. What are motor drive wheels?


Motor drive wheels are the components that provide propulsion and control to Automated Guided Vehicles (AGVs), essential for their movement and stability in various applications.

2. How do I choose the right motor drive wheels for my AGV?


Choosing the right motor drive wheels involves considering factors such as load capacity, surface conditions, speed requirements, and environmental factors.

3. What maintenance is required for motor drive wheels?


Regular maintenance includes inspecting for wear and damage, ensuring proper alignment, and making necessary adjustments to maintain optimal performance.

4. Can motor drive wheel technology impact energy efficiency?


Yes, high-quality and efficient motor drive wheels can significantly reduce power consumption, leading to lower operational costs and extended battery life.

5. How often should I upgrade my AGV’s motor drive wheels?


The frequency of upgrades depends on the wear and performance of the wheels. Regular inspections can help determine when it’s time for replacement or upgrade.
